WHAT’S THE STORY?
1. Tom Meagher says Irish people need to examine how they look at violence against women.
2. A police officer won’t be charged over the shooting of a teen in Ferguson - leading to violent protests.
3. A baby was thrown to safety from a house fire in Dublin.
4. Gerry Adams apologised for using the word ‘bastards’ when talking about some unionists.
5. Another apology, this time from John Delaney for singing a Republican song.
6. Lee Rigby’s killers were tracked by MI5 before his death.
Main pic: Demonstrators protest in Oakland, California after grand jury decision not to indict Ferguson police officer Darren Wilson in the fatal shooting of Michael Brown, an unarmed 18-year-old. (AP Photo/Noah Berger)
